Free Dmitry Free Dmitry MARCH ON THE FEDERAL BUILDING Free Dmitry Free Dmitry Thursday, August 30, 2001, 11:30 AM Meet at Moscone Center, San Francisco, California, USA Please join history's largest and most successful fair use movement in a San Francisco march to free Russian programmer Dmitry Sklyarov. At the request of Adobe Systems of San Jose, Dmitry was arrested by the FBI in Las Vegas on July 16th. Following previous demonstrations by people like you, Adobe dropped their support of Dmitry's prosecution, and the US government has released him on $50,000 bail. Now it's time to turn out the largest Free Dmitry rally ever, to demand that the government drop the charges for good. "The U.S. government for the first time is prosecuting a programmer for building a tool that may be used for many purposes, including those that legitimate purchasers need in order to exercise their fair use rights," said Electronic Frontier Foundation attorney Robin Gross. Other demonstrations will be held worldwide.
